Day 01: Delhi
Arrive Delhi. Transfer to your hotel
Day 02: Delhi
Full day tour of new & old Delhi including Laxmi Narayan
Temple, India Gate, Jama Masjid, Red Fort & Raj Ghat.
Day 03: Delhi - Varanasi
Morning, fly to to Varanasi, the mind soothing destination.
Afternoon, take an excursion to Buddhist town of Sarnath,
where Lord Buddha preached his first sermon after
enlightenment.
Day 04: Varanasi - Agra
Boat ride on River Ganges, followed by a city tour covering
Alamgir Mosque or Beni Madhav Ka Darera, Dasaswamedha Ghat,
Benares Hindu University and The Bharat Mata Temple.
Afternoon, fly to Agra. Visit Red fort, Tomb of
Itmad-ud-Daula's.
Day 05: Agra - Khajuraho
Morning, visit Taj Mahal and drive to the airport for flight
to Khajuraho. Afternoon, proceed on the city tour covering
western/eastern group of Temples. The temples at Khajuraho
are a unique gift to the world.
Day 06: Khajuraho - Orchha - Gwalior
Drive to Orchha, medieval legacy in stone. Visit Jehangir
Mahal, Raj Mahal, Chaturbhuj Temple and drive to Gwalior.
Day 07: Gwalior - Shivpuri
Visit the magnificent Gwalior Fort which houses a marvellous
Palace, Man Mandir Palace, Sas Bahu Ka Mandir, Suraj Kund
etc;. Also visit the tombs of Tansen and Ghias Mohammed, the
Museum in Jai Vilas Palace and the newly built Sun temple
located on the outskirts and dedicated to Sun God. Drive to
Shivpuri.
Day 08: Shivpuri
Visit elegant Chatris or cenotaphs of Shivpuri. Also visit
Bhadaiya Kund, a scenic spot noted for its natural mineral
spring. Afternoon, visit to Madhav National Park.
Day 09: Shivpuri - Ujjain
Drive to Ujjain. Rest of the day is free.
Day 10: Ujjain
Visit this renowned pilgrim centre including Mahakaleshwar
Temple which enshrines one of the 12 Jyotirlingams, Bada
Ganeshji Ka Mandir. Also visit Kaliadeh Palace.
Day 11: Ujjain - Mandu
Depart for Indore and visit Kanch Mandir - a Jain temple.
Visit the Ujjain Museum which has one of the best
collections of medieval and pre-medieval Hindu Sculpture in
Madhya Pradesh. Afternoon, drive to Mandu.
Day 12: Mandu
Mandu, the city of Joy, is full of legends of love and
glory, specially those of Baz Bahadur and the beautiful
Roopmati. Visit several noteworthy palaces and pavilions
some of which are Ashrafi Mahal- the Palace of gold coins,
Rewa Kund Group and Hindola Mahal (swinging Palace).
Day 13: Mandu - Bhopal
Drive to Bhopal with stop in Indore.
Day 14: Bhopal - Sanchi - Bhopal
Excursion to Sanchi, the ancient seat of Buddhist learning.
Visit the archeological museum, the Great Stupa,
Taj-ul-Masjid, Laxmi Narayan Temple and Birla Museum.
Taj-ul-Masjid is one of the largest mosques in India.
Day 15: Bhopal - Panchmarhi
Drive to Panchmarhi visiting Bhimbetka en route. Paintings
in over 500 caves in Bhimbetka depict the life of the
pre-historic dwellers in vivid, panoramic detail.
Day 16: Panchmarhi
Panchmarhi, a lovely hill station in Madhya Pradesh
surrounded by beautiful forests, full of breathtaking
waterfalls, serene pools and quiet glades. Late afternoon,
excursion to Dhupgarh for sunset view which is the highest
point in the Satpura hills.
Day 17: Panchmarhi - Jabalpur
Leave for Jabalpur, a big city in Madhya Pradesh by road
passing through India’s agricultural heartland. Afternoon,
visit Sadar bazaar and take a boat ride in Marble Rocks, a
natural maze on the Narmada river.
Day 18: Jabalpur - Mumbai
Transfer to the railway station and depart for overnight
train journey to Mumbai.
Day 19: Mumbai
Arrive Mumbai, the cosmopolitan city with the potpourri of
cultures and glamour. Visit Colaba, Prince of Wales Museum,
Mahalaxmi Temple & Tomb of Haji Ali. If time permits, visit
Kalbadevi Bazaar and Chowpatty Beach, a famous beach that
offers fun activities such pony rides, acrobatic
performances, food and juice stalls etc; together with a
wonderful view of the coast.
Day 20: Mumbai - Departure
Departure transfer for the onward destination.
